We study if the evidence for the optically luminous subclass of radio
quasars (Teerikorpi 2000, 2001), depends on the Friedmann model used,
especially on the presence or not of a Λ term.
Previously this grouping, with distinct properties,
was found at (
,
).
The cosmological Malmquist bias approach shows
that the member candidates, separated by an empty luminosity range from fainter
quasars, as well or better appear in the currently
favoured flat models with a non-zero Λ.
We briefly illustrate the effect of Λ on the Malmquist bias,
depending on the steeper volume derivative and longer
luminosity distance in Λ models.
